Gaming News - May 2004


Redwood City, CA (May 5, 2004) - Electronic Arts announced today that they have shipped UEFA EURO 2004.


From EA:

Get ready soccer fans! We are excited to tell you that UEFA EURO 2004 has shipped under the EA SPORTS brand for the PlayStation 2, Xbox, and PC. UEFA EURO 2004 was developed to coincide with the finals of the UEFA EURO 2004 tournament in Portugal and is the officially licensed game of the tournament, which begins in June.

In UEFA EURO 2004, gamers can play as any of the 51 European nations as you immerse yourself in the deepest championship mode ever released. Players can arrange and play friendly matches against other nations or play through the tournament going from qualifying, to playoffs and into the finals. In addition to tracking injuries and suspensions, a new dynamic morale system will track players' morale, which will fluctuate based on individual and team performances and affect player abilities on the field.

UEFA EURO 2004 was developed by EA Canada and is rated “E” (Everyone) by the ESRB. The USMSRP is $39.95 for the console versions and $29.95 for the PC version.
